An-Nisa · 47/176
Translation Transliteration — An-Nisa
يَا أَيُّهَا الَّذِينَ أُوتُوا الْكِتَابَ آمِنُوا بِمَا نَزَّلْنَا مُصَدِّقًا لِّمَا مَعَكُم مِّن قَبْلِ أَن نَّطْمِسَ وُجُوهًا فَنَرُدَّهَا عَلَىٰ أَدْبَارِهَا أَوْ نَلْعَنَهُمْ كَمَا لَعَنَّا أَصْحَابَ السَّبْتِ ۚ وَكَانَ أَمْرُ اللَّهِ مَفْعُولًا ۝٤٧
yaaa aiyuha lazeena ootu Kitaaba aaminoo bimaa nazzalnaa musadiqallimaa ma`akum min qabli an natmisa wujoohan fanaruddahaa `alaaa adbaarihaaa aw nal`anahum kamaa la`annaaa Ashaabas Sabt; wa kaana amrul laahi maf`oolaa
📖 English Meaning
O you who were given the Scripture, believe in what We have sent down [to Muhammad], confirming that which is with you, before We obliterate faces and turn them toward their backs or curse them as We cursed the sabbath-breakers. And ever is the decree of Allah accomplished.

Word Meanings:

  • "Natmisa" (نَطْمِسَ): To erase, obliterate, or wipe out completely—removing all traces of features.
  • "Wujūhan" (وُجُوهًا): Faces.
  • "Naruddahā" (نَرُدَّهَا): To turn them back or reverse them.
  • "Adbārihā" (أَدْبَارِهَا): Their backs—meaning to make the face like the back of the head.
  • "Nal'anahum" (نَلْعَنَهُمْ): To curse them—to cast them far from Allah's mercy.
  • "Aṣḥāb al-Sabt" (أَصْحَابَ السَّبْتِ): The people of the Sabbath—the Jews who violated the sanctity of Saturday by fishing on that day.

Tafsir (Explanation):

O you who have been given the Scripture—the Jews and the Christians—believe sincerely and act upon what We have sent down to Our final Messenger Muhammad (peace be upon him), namely the Qur'an. This Qur'an confirms the truth that is already with you in the Torah and the Gospel, affirming the core messages of monotheism and the coming of the final Prophet. Do this before the punishment of Allah descends upon you, for His decree is certain and His justice is swift.

Allah warns of two possible punishments if they persist in disbelief: First, He may erase their faces—blotting out their eyes, noses, and brows—and turn them backward, so that their faces become like the backs of their heads, a terrifying disfigurement that strips them of their human dignity. Second, He may curse them as He cursed the people of the Sabbath—those Jews who transgressed by fishing on Saturday despite being explicitly forbidden. Their punishment was to be transformed into despised apes and swine, cast out from Allah's mercy entirely.

This is a dire warning, but it is also an invitation of mercy. Allah is not quick to punish; He gives ample time for repentance and faith. The verse calls them to embrace the truth while the door is still open, before the inevitable decree of Allah takes effect. And the command of Allah is always fulfilled—nothing can delay it or stand in its way.

📜 Verse 45-49 — An-Nisa

45وَاللَّهُ أَعْلَمُ بِأَعْدَائِكُمْ ۚ وَكَفَىٰ بِاللَّهِ وَلِيًّا وَكَفَىٰ بِاللَّهِ نَصِيرًا
And Allah is most knowing of your enemies; and sufficient is Allah as an ally, and sufficient is Allah as a helper.
46مِّنَ الَّذِينَ هَادُوا يُحَرِّفُونَ الْكَلِمَ عَن مَّوَاضِعِهِ وَيَقُولُونَ سَمِعْنَا وَعَصَيْنَا وَاسْمَعْ غَيْرَ مُسْمَعٍ وَرَاعِنَا لَيًّا بِأَلْسِنَتِهِمْ وَطَعْنًا فِي الدِّينِ ۚ وَلَوْ أَنَّهُمْ قَالُوا سَمِعْنَا وَأَطَعْنَا وَاسْمَعْ وَانظُرْنَا لَكَانَ خَيْرًا لَّهُمْ وَأَقْوَمَ وَلَٰكِن لَّعَنَهُمُ اللَّهُ بِكُفْرِهِمْ فَلَا يُؤْمِنُونَ إِلَّا قَلِيلًا
Among the Jews are those who distort words from their [proper] usages and say, "We hear and disobey" and "Hear but be not heard" and "Ra'ina," twisting their tongues and defaming the religion. And if they had said [instead], "We hear and obey" and "Wait for us [to understand]," it would have been better for them and more suitable. But Allah has cursed them for their disbelief, so they believe not, except for a few.
47يَا أَيُّهَا الَّذِينَ أُوتُوا الْكِتَابَ آمِنُوا بِمَا نَزَّلْنَا مُصَدِّقًا لِّمَا مَعَكُم مِّن قَبْلِ أَن نَّطْمِسَ وُجُوهًا فَنَرُدَّهَا عَلَىٰ أَدْبَارِهَا أَوْ نَلْعَنَهُمْ كَمَا لَعَنَّا أَصْحَابَ السَّبْتِ ۚ وَكَانَ أَمْرُ اللَّهِ مَفْعُولًا
O you who were given the Scripture, believe in what We have sent down [to Muhammad], confirming that which is with you, before We obliterate faces and turn them toward their backs or curse them as We cursed the sabbath-breakers. And ever is the decree of Allah accomplished.
48إِنَّ اللَّهَ لَا يَغْفِرُ أَن يُشْرَكَ بِهِ وَيَغْفِرُ مَا دُونَ ذَٰلِكَ لِمَن يَشَاءُ ۚ وَمَن يُشْرِكْ بِاللَّهِ فَقَدِ افْتَرَىٰ إِثْمًا عَظِيمًا
Indeed, Allah does not forgive association with Him, but He forgives what is less than that for whom He wills. And he who associates others with Allah has certainly fabricated a tremendous sin.
49أَلَمْ تَرَ إِلَى الَّذِينَ يُزَكُّونَ أَنفُسَهُم ۚ بَلِ اللَّهُ يُزَكِّي مَن يَشَاءُ وَلَا يُظْلَمُونَ فَتِيلًا
Have you not seen those who claim themselves to be pure? Rather, Allah purifies whom He wills, and injustice is not done to them, [even] as much as a thread [inside a date seed].
